what is the conversion factor for nm3 to kg/hr in air flow..

Answer / hermann

1Nm3 (normal m3) of air is a volume of 1m3 of air under normal conditions of pressure (1 atm = 101.330 kPa) and temperature (0 deg C = 273 K) (Europe); Since air can be assumed to behave as an ideal gas under those conditions, its compressibility factor is 1; so in the relation:PV=ZmRT; Z=1;R for air= 0.287 kPa.m3/(kg.K); V=1m3; therefore 101.330*1=1*m*0.287*273; so m = 1.295 kg. Conversion factor: 1 Nm3/hr = 1.295 kg/hr

what is the conversion factor for nm3 to kg/hr in air flow..

Answer / rajesh gajera

The ideal gas law demonstrates that: PV=nRT in which n=m/M n= mole number m= mass or mass flow (kg/h) V= volume or volumetric flow (m3/hr) M= molecular weight of the gas for example Molecular weight of nitrogen (N2) =28 kg/kgmole In Normal conditions according to the latest SI definition P=100 kpa and T=0 C or 273.15 K R = gas constant =8.314 pa.m3/mol.K So, PV=(m/M)*R*T or m(kg/h) = (P*V*M)/(R*T) at Normal conditions then we have: m(kg/h) = M* 100* V (Nm3/h) / (8.314*273.15) or m(kg/h) = 0.044 M* V (Nm3/h) example: 20 Nm3/h of Nitrogen is equal to: m = 0.044* 28 (molecular weight) * 20 (Nm3/h) m = 7 kg/h
